Single row deep groove ball bearings are one of the most commonly used types of bearings in industrial machinery. Their design consists of an inner ring, an outer ring, a set of balls, and a cage to ensure proper ball spacing. These bearings are known for their versatility and ability to handle both radial and axial loads, making them suitable for a wide range of applications.
One of the key advantages of single row deep groove ball bearings is their low friction coefficient. This feature allows for efficient operation and minimal heat generation, contributing to enhanced performance and longevity of machinery. Additionally, the deep groove design enables these bearings to accommodate high-speed rotations, making them ideal for applications that require rapid motion.
The applications of single row deep groove ball bearings span across various industries, including automotive, manufacturing, agriculture, and more. In the automotive sector, these bearings find utility in wheel hubs, engines, and transmissions. Within the manufacturing industry, they are used in conveyor systems, pumps, and electric motors. Their reliability and durability make them indispensable in heavy-duty applications such as mining and construction equipment.
To ensure optimal performance and longevity, it is crucial to consider several factors when selecting single row deep groove ball bearings. These factors include load capacity, operating temperature, speed requirements, and environmental conditions. Adequate lubrication is also essential to minimize friction and prevent premature wear.
